Description:

SUMMARY

The Quality Food Safety Specialist supports food safety, quality assurance, and regulatory compliance across all facilities. This role conducts environmental and product testing, verifies food safety programs, supports audits, and partners closely with Production and Quality teams to ensure all products meet high standards for safety, quality, and consistency. This position also plays a key role in training, documentation, and continuous improvement initiatives that strengthen the company’s SQF, HACCP, and GMP programs.


ESSENTIAL DUTIES

Food Safety & Quality Verification

  • Monitor, verify, and validate HACCP, SQF, and GMP programs to ensure compliance with regulatory, customer, and internal standards.
  • Review, maintain, and verify production, sanitation, allergen, temperature, receiving, and environmental monitoring records.
  • Conduct environmental, bacteriological, chemical, and physical testing of raw materials, packaging, in-process samples, and finished products.
  • Complete daily product release logs and ensure finished goods meet safety and quality specifications.
  • Prepare and submit samples to external labs as needed.
  • Lead, support, and trend results for the environmental monitoring program and other verification/validation programs.

Documentation & Recordkeeping

  • Ensure all food safety and quality records are complete, accurate, reviewed, and properly stored.
  • Prepare reports, maintain data logs, and assist in SOP, SSOP, and process documentation updates.
  • Assist with product investigations, customer complaints, and corrective action follow-up.

Training & Internal Support

  • Assist with training for GMPs, HACCP basics, chemical safety, and food safety requirements.
  • Assist with developing training materials aligned with regulatory, customer, and internal standards.
  • Serve as a resource to cross-functional teams, providing timely guidance and support for quality-related questions or issues.

Audits & Compliance

  • Participate in internal audits and help maintain compliance with state, federal, and certification body requirements (SQF, Organic, Kosher, etc.).
  • Assist and support third-party audits, including SQF, customer audits, Organic, Kosher, and regulatory inspections.
  • Serve as a backup to the SQF Practitioner.

Continuous Improvement

  • Identify areas for process improvement related to food safety, sanitation, product consistency, and operational efficiency.
  • Recommend updates to policies, procedures, and programs to strengthen food safety systems.
  • Partner with leadership and production teams to troubleshoot quality issues and support root-cause analysis.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Bachelor’s degree in Food Science, Microbiology, Chemistry, or related scientific/technical field.
  • 2–3 years of experience in food safety, quality assurance, laboratory work, R&D, or food processing preferred.
  • Knowledge of HACCP, GMPs, SQF, and quality management systems.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ills; able to train and influence others.
  • Able to work independently, prioritize tasks, and make sound decisions with minimal supervision.
  • Able to manage quality issues with a sense of urgency and close attention to detail.
  • Alignment with Open Gates’ mission, values, and culture of continuous improvement.

CERTIFICATE & TRAINING REQUIREMENTS

  • PCQI certification (or ability to obtain).
  • HACCP certification (or ability to obtain).

PHYSICAL & WORK REQUIREMENTS

  • Ability to sit, stand, walk, bend, and lift occasionally as required.
  • Work may involve exposure to production environments, including cold, humidity, chemicals, and moving mechanical equipment.
  • Must be able to adjust focus and differentiate color for testing
